Buchanan AL, Hernández-Ramírez RU, Lok JJ, Vermund SH, Friedman SR, Forastiere L, Spiegelman D. Assessing Direct and Spillover Effects of Intervention Packages in Network-randomized Studies. Epidemiology 2024; 35:481-488. [PMID: 38709023 DOI: 10.1097/ede.0000000000001742]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 05/07/2024]
Abstract
BACKGROUND Intervention packages may result in a greater public health impact than single interventions. Understanding the separate impact of each component on the overall package effectiveness can improve intervention delivery. METHODS We adapted an approach to evaluate the effects of a time-varying intervention package in a network-randomized study. In some network-randomized studies, only a subset of participants in exposed networks receive the intervention themselves. The spillover effect contrasts average potential outcomes if a person was not exposed to themselves under intervention in the network versus no intervention in a control network. We estimated the effects of components of the intervention package in HIV Prevention Trials Network 037, a Phase III network-randomized HIV prevention trial among people who inject drugs and their risk networks using marginal structural models to adjust for time-varying confounding. The index participant in an intervention network received a peer education intervention initially at baseline, then boosters at 6 and 12 months. All participants were followed to ascertain HIV risk behaviors. RESULTS There were 560 participants with at least one follow-up visit, 48% of whom were randomized to the intervention, and 1,598 participant visits were observed. The spillover effect of the boosters in the presence of initial peer education training was a 39% rate reduction (rate ratio = 0.61; 95% confidence interval = 0.43, 0.87). CONCLUSIONS These methods will be useful for evaluating intervention packages in studies with network features.

Wongso LV, Rahadi A, Sukmaningrum E, Handayani M, Wisaksana R. Acceptability of a pilot motivational interviewing intervention at public health facilities to improve the HIV treatment cascade among people who inject drugs in Indonesia. Harm Reduct J 2024; 21:73. [PMID: 38561793 PMCID: PMC10985935 DOI: 10.1186/s12954-024-00989-w]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/18/2023] [Accepted: 03/21/2024] [Indexed: 04/04/2024] Open
Abstract
BACKGROUND HIV-positive people who inject drugs (PWID) experience challenges in initiating and adhering to antiretroviral treatment (ART). Counselling using motivational interviewing (MI) techniques may help them formulate individualised strategies, and execute actions to address these challenges collaboratively with their providers. We evaluated the acceptability of MI from a pilot implementation at three public health facilities in Indonesia. METHODS Adapting the acceptability constructs developed by Sekhon (2017) we assessed the acceptability to HIV-positive PWID clients (n = 12) and providers (n = 10) in four synthesised constructs: motivation (attributes that inspire engagement); cost consideration (sacrifices made to engage in MI); learned understanding (mechanism of action); and outcomes (ability to effect change with engagement). We included all providers and clients who completed ≥ 2 MI encounters. Qualitative analysis with an interpretive paradigm was used to extract and categorise themes by these constructs. RESULTS In motivation, clients valued the open communication style of MI, while providers appreciated its novelty in offering coherent structure with clear boundaries. In cost consideration, both groups faced a challenge in meeting MI encounters due to access or engagement in other health care areas. In learned understanding, clients understood that MI worked to identify problematic areas of life amenable to change to support long-term ART, with reconciliation in family life being the most targeted change. By contrast, providers preferred targeting tangible health outcomes to such behavioural proxies. In outcomes, clients were confident in their ability to develop behaviours to sustain ART uptakes, whereas providers doubted the outcome of MI on younger PWID or those with severe dependence. CONCLUSIONS There is broad acceptability of MI in motivating engagement for both actors. Relative to providers, clients were more acceptable in its mechanism and had greater confidence to perform behaviours conducive to ART engagement. Design innovations to improve the acceptability of MI for both actors are needed.

Demeke J, Djiadeu P, Yusuf A, Whitfield DL, Lightfoot D, Worku F, Abu-Ba'are GR, Mbuagbaw L, Giwa S, Nelson LE. HIV Prevention and Treatment Interventions for Black Men Who Have Sex With Men in Canada: Scoping Systematic Review. JMIR Public Health Surveill 2024; 10:e40493. [PMID: 38236626 PMCID: PMC10835596 DOI: 10.2196/40493]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/23/2022] [Revised: 12/28/2022] [Accepted: 08/29/2023] [Indexed: 01/19/2024] Open
Abstract
BACKGROUND Black men who have sex with men (MSM) experience disproportionately high HIV incidence globally. A comprehensive, intersectional approach (race, gender, and sexuality or sexual behavior) in understanding the experiences of Black MSM in Canada along the HIV prevention and care continuums has yet to be explored. OBJECTIVE This scoping review aims to examine the available evidence on the access, quality, gaps, facilitators, and barriers of engagement and identify interventions relevant to the HIV prevention and care continuum for Black MSM in Canada. METHODS We conducted a systematic database search, in accordance with the PRISMA-ScR (Preferred Reporting Items for Systematic Reviews and Meta-Analyses extension for Scoping Reviews) checklist, of the available studies on HIV health experience and epidemiology concerning Black MSM living with or without HIV in Canada and were published after 1983 in either English or French. Searched databases include MEDLINE, Excerpta, Cumulative Index to Nursing and Allied Health Literature, the Cochrane Library, the NHUS Economic Development Database, Global Health, PsycInfo, PubMed, Scopus, and Web of Science. From the 3095 articles identified, 19 met the inclusion criteria and were analyzed. RESULTS Black MSM in Canada consistently report multiple forms of stigma and lack of community support contributing to an increased HIV burden. They experience discrimination based on their intersectional identities while accessing HIV preventative and treatment interventions. Available data demonstrate that Black MSM have higher HIV incidences than Black men who have sex with women (MSW) and White MSM, and low preexposure prophylaxis knowledge and HIV literacy. Black MSM experience significant disparities in HIV prevention and care knowledge, access, and use. Structural barriers, including anti-Black racism, homophobia, and xenophobia, are responsible for gaps in HIV prevention and care continuums, poor quality of care and linkage to HIV services, as well as a higher incidence of HIV. CONCLUSIONS Considering the lack of targeted interventions, there is a clear need for interventions that reduce HIV diagnoses among Black MSM, increase access and reduce structural barriers that significantly affect the ability of Black MSM to engage with HIV prevention and care, and address provider's capacity for care and the structural barriers. These findings can inform future interventions, programming, and tools that may alleviate this HIV inequity. INTERNATIONAL REGISTERED REPORT IDENTIFIER (IRRID) RR2-10.1136/bmjopen-2020-043055.

Dumchev K, Guo X, Ha TV, Djoerban Z, Zeziulin O, Go VF, Sarasvita R, Metzger DS, Latkin CA, Rose SM, Piwowar-Manning E, Richardson P, Hanscom B, Lancaster KE, Miller WC, Hoffman IF. Causes and risk factors of death among people who inject drugs in Indonesia, Ukraine and Vietnam: findings from HPTN 074 randomized trial. BMC Infect Dis 2023; 23:319. [PMID: 37170118 PMCID: PMC10173611 DOI: 10.1186/s12879-023-08201-3]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/09/2022] [Accepted: 03/27/2023] [Indexed: 05/13/2023] Open
Abstract
INTRODUCTION The HIV Prevention Trials Network (HPTN) 074 study demonstrated a positive effect of an integrated systems navigation and psychosocial counseling intervention on HIV treatment initiation, viral suppression, medication assisted treatment (MAT) enrollment, and risk of death among people who inject drugs (PWID). In this sub-study, we analyzed the incidence, causes, and predictors of death among HIV-infected and uninfected participants. METHODS The HPTN 074 randomized clinical trial was conducted in Indonesia, Ukraine, and Vietnam. HIV-infected PWID with unsuppressed viral load (indexes) were recruited together with at least one of their HIV-negative injection partners. Indexes were randomized in a 1:3 ratio to the intervention or standard of care. RESULTS The trial enrolled 502 index and 806 partner participants. Overall, 13% (66/502) of indexes and 3% (19/806) of partners died during follow-up (crude mortality rates 10.4 [95% CI 8.1-13.3] and 2.1 [1.3-3.3], respectively). These mortality rates were for indexes nearly 30 times and for partners 6 times higher than expected in a population of the same country, age, and gender (standardized mortality ratios 30.7 [23.7-39.0] and 5.8 [3.5-9.1], respectively). HIV-related causes, including a recent CD4 < 200 cells/μL, accounted for 50% of deaths among indexes. Among partners, medical conditions were the most common cause of death (47%). In the multivariable Cox model, the mortality among indexes was associated with sex (male versus female aHR = 4.2 [1.5-17.9]), CD4 count (≥ 200 versus < 200 cells/μL aHR = 0.3 [0.2-0.5]), depression (moderate-to-severe versus no/mild aHR = 2.6 [1.2-5.0]) and study arm (intervention versus control aHR = 0.4 [0.2-0.9]). Among partners, the study arm of the index remained the only significant predictor (intervention versus control aHR = 0.2 [0.0-0.9]) while controlling for the effect of MAT (never versus ever receiving MAT aHR = 2.4 [0.9-7.4]). CONCLUSIONS The results confirm that both HIV-infected and uninfected PWID remain at a starkly elevated risk of death compared to general population. Mortality related to HIV and other causes can be significantly reduced by scaling-up ART and MAT. Access to these life-saving treatments can be effectively improved by flexible integrated interventions, such as the one developed and tested in HPTN 074.

Lancaster KE, Mollan KR, Hanscom BS, Shook-Sa BE, Ha TV, Dumchev K, Djoerban Z, Rose SM, Latkin CA, Metzger DS, Go VF, Dvoriak S, Reifeis SA, Piwowar-Manning EM, Richardson P, Hudgens MG, Hamilton EL, Eshleman SH, Susami H, Chu VA, Djauzi S, Kiriazova T, Nhan DT, Burns DN, Miller WC, Hoffman IF. Engaging People Who Inject Drugs Living With HIV in Antiretroviral Treatment and Medication for Opioid Use Disorder: Extended Follow-up of HIV Prevention Trials Network (HPTN) 074. Open Forum Infect Dis 2021; 8:ofab281. [PMID: 34458390 PMCID: PMC8391093 DOI: 10.1093/ofid/ofab281]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/28/2021] [Accepted: 05/28/2021] [Indexed: 11/14/2022] Open
Abstract
BACKGROUND People who inject drugs (PWID) living with HIV experience inadequate access to antiretroviral treatment (ART) and medication for opioid use disorders (MOUD). HPTN 074 showed that an integrated intervention increased ART use and viral suppression over 52 weeks. To examine durability of ART, MOUD, and HIV viral suppression, participants could re-enroll for an extended follow-up period, during which standard-of-care (SOC) participants in need of support were offered the intervention. METHODS Participants were recruited from Ukraine, Indonesia and Vietnam and randomly allocated 3:1 to SOC or intervention. Eligibility criteria included: HIV-positive; active injection drug use; 18-60 years of age; ≥1 HIV-uninfected injection partner; and viral load ≥1,000 copies/mL. Re-enrollment was offered to all available intervention and SOC arm participants, and SOC participants in need of support (off-ART or off-MOUD) were offered the intervention. RESULTS The intervention continuation group re-enrolled 89 participants, and from week 52 to 104, viral suppression (<40 copies/mL) declined from 41% to 29% (estimated 9.4% decrease per year, 95% CI -17.0%; -1.8%). The in need of support group re-enrolled 94 participants and had increased ART (re-enrollment: 55%, week 26: 69%) and MOUD (re-enrollment: 16%, week 26: 25%) use, and viral suppression (re-enrollment: 40%, week 26: 49%). CONCLUSIONS Viral suppression declined in year 2 for those who initially received the HPTN 074 intervention and improved maintenance support is warranted. Viral suppression and MOUD increased among in need participants who received intervention during the study extension. Continued efforts are needed for widespread implementation of this scalable, integrated intervention.

Kiriazova T, Go VF, Hershow RB, Hamilton EL, Sarasvita R, Bui Q, Lancaster KE, Dumchev K, Hoffman IF, Miller WC, Latkin CA. Perspectives of clients and providers on factors influencing opioid agonist treatment uptake among HIV-positive people who use drugs in Indonesia, Ukraine, and Vietnam: HPTN 074 study. Harm Reduct J 2020; 17:69. [PMID: 32998731 PMCID: PMC7528574 DOI: 10.1186/s12954-020-00415-x]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/13/2020] [Accepted: 09/16/2020] [Indexed: 12/23/2022] Open
Abstract
BACKGROUND Opioid agonist treatment (OAT) is an effective method of addiction treatment and HIV prevention. However, globally, people who inject drugs (PWID) have insufficient OAT uptake. To expand OAT access and uptake, policymakers, program developers and healthcare providers should be aware of barriers to and facilitators of OAT uptake among PWID. METHODS As a part of the HPTN 074 study, which assessed the feasibility of an intervention to facilitate HIV treatment and OAT in PWID living with HIV in Indonesia, Ukraine, and Vietnam, we conducted in-depth interviews with 37 HIV-positive PWID and 25 healthcare providers to explore barriers to and facilitators of OAT uptake. All interviews were audio-recorded, transcribed, translated into English, and coded in NVivo for analysis. We developed matrices to identify emergent themes and patterns. RESULTS Despite some reported country-specific factors, PWID and healthcare providers at all geographic locations reported similar barriers to OAT initiation, such as complicated procedures to initiate OAT, problematic clinic access, lack of information on OAT, misconceptions about methadone, financial burden, and stigma toward PWID. However, while PWID reported fear of drug interaction (OAT and antiretroviral therapy), providers perceived that PWID prioritized drug use over caring for their health and hence were less motivated to take up ART and OAT. Motivation for a life change and social support were reported to be facilitators. CONCLUSION These results highlight a need for support for PWID to initiate and retain in drug treatment. To expand OAT in all three countries, it is necessary to facilitate access and ensure low-threshold, financially affordable OAT programs for PWID, accompanied with supporting interventions. PWID attitudes and beliefs about OAT indicate the need for informational campaigns to counter misinformation and stigma associated with addiction and OAT (especially methadone).

Nguyen MXB, Chu AV, Powell BJ, Tran HV, Nguyen LH, Dao ATM, Pham MD, Vo SH, Bui NH, Dowdy DW, Latkin CA, Lancaster KE, Pence BW, Sripaipan T, Hoffman I, Miller WC, Go VF. Comparing a standard and tailored approach to scaling up an evidence-based intervention for antiretroviral therapy for people who inject drugs in Vietnam: study protocol for a cluster randomized hybrid type III trial. Implement Sci 2020; 15:64. [PMID: 32771017 PMCID: PMC7414564 DOI: 10.1186/s13012-020-01020-z]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/01/2020] [Accepted: 07/08/2020] [Indexed: 12/03/2022] Open
Abstract
Background People who inject drugs (PWID) bear a disproportionate burden of HIV infection and experience poor outcomes. A randomized trial demonstrated the efficacy of an integrated System Navigation and Psychosocial Counseling (SNaP) intervention in improving HIV outcomes, including antiretroviral therapy (ART) and medications for opioid use disorder (MOUD) uptake, viral suppression, and mortality. There is limited evidence about how to effectively scale such intervention. This protocol presents a hybrid type III effectiveness-implementation trial comparing two approaches for scaling-up SNaP. We will evaluate the effectiveness of SNaP implementation approaches as well as cost and the characteristics of HIV testing sites achieving successful or unsuccessful implementation of SNaP in Vietnam. Methods Design: In this cluster randomized controlled trial, two approaches to scaling-up SNaP for PWID in Vietnam will be compared. HIV testing sites (n = 42) were randomized 1:1 to the standard approach or the tailored approach. Intervention mapping was used to develop implementation strategies for both arms. The standard arm will receive a uniform package of these strategies, while implementation strategies for the tailored arm will be designed to address site-specific needs. Participants: HIV-positive PWID participants (n = 6200) will be recruited for medical record assessment at baseline; of those, 1500 will be enrolled for detailed assessments at baseline, 12, and 24 months. Site directors and staff at each of the 42 HIV testing sites will complete surveys at baseline, 12, and 24 months. Outcomes: Implementation outcomes (fidelity, penetration, acceptability) and effectiveness outcomes (ART, MOUD uptake, viral suppression) will be compared between the arms. To measure incremental costs, we will conduct an empirical costing study of each arm and the actual process of implementation from a societal perspective. Qualitative and quantitative site-level data will be used to explore key characteristics of HIV testing sites that successfully or unsuccessfully implement the intervention for each arm. Discussion Scaling up evidence-based interventions poses substantial challenges. The proposed trial contributes to the field of implementation science by applying a systematic approach to designing and tailoring implementation strategies, conducting a rigorous comparison of two promising implementation approaches, and assessing their incremental costs. Our study will provide critical guidance to Ministries of Health worldwide regarding the most effective, cost-efficient approach to SNaP implementation. Trial registration NCT03952520 on Clinialtrials.gov. Registered 16 May 2019.

Rozanova J, Shenoi S, Zaviryukha I, Zeziulin O, Kiriazova T, Rich K, Mamedova E, Yariy V. Social Support is Key to Retention in Care during Covid-19 Pandemic among Older People with HIV and Substance Use Disorders in Ukraine. Subst Use Misuse 2020; 55:1902-1904. [PMID: 32666857 PMCID: PMC7523433 DOI: 10.1080/10826084.2020.1791183] [Citation(s) in RCA: 12]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/14/2022]
Abstract
BACKGROUND Older people with human immunodeficiency virus - HIV (OPWH) defined as ≥50 years old account for a growing proportion of newly diagnosed infections in Ukraine (16% in 2018), but the prevalence of substance use disorder among OPWH in Ukraine remains unknown. Ukraine responded to the Covid-19 pandemic with a comprehensive lockdown in late March 2020. Objectives: We conducted a phone survey among 123 OPWH with substance use disorders (SUD) in Kyiv in May 2020 to learn if these older adults may continue HIV and SUD therapy while coping with the Covid-19 pandemic. Results: Data from the survey demonstrated that while OPWH with SUD maintained HIV and SUD therapy throughout Covid-19 lockdown, social support is critical to avoiding treatment interruption for OPWH with SUD. Conclusions/Importance: During reopening, reduction of support may lead to OPWH feeling even more isolated. Post-Covid-19 pharmacological approaches to SUD treatment without social support are like vehicles without gas. The research agenda for OPWH patients with SUD going forward must include determining the type of telehealth support that will be optimally effective to retain OPWH including people who inject drugs (PWID), provision of support by lay health workers, and cost-effectiveness of such interventions. The lessons learned may be relevant to other countries as well.
